Synopsis by Mark Deming
In this offbeat experimental feature filmed in the United States and Greece, Petra Going (Lizzie Martinez) is an agent with a shadowy intelligence agency, the Global Nomad Project. Petra travels the four corners of the globe recording her remarkable adventures and taking her rocking chair with her every place she goes; animation, manipulated video, title cards, and abstract audio collages are used to convey her strange stories. The Slow Business of Going was directed by Athina Rachel Tsangari, one of the founders of the Cinematexas Film Festival.
